Biography
Jerzy Stolarow was a Polish tennis player born on April 24, 1898. He gained prominence in the early 20th century, representing Poland in various international tournaments. Stolarow's athletic prowess and competitive spirit made him a notable figure in Polish tennis history.
Throughout his career, Stolarow achieved significant milestones, including participation in the French Championships and other prestigious events. He was known for his skillful play and contributed to the growth of tennis in Poland during his active years.
